Enhanced Hydrogen Evolution on Ru‐Modified Cu1.8Se/Cu2Se Catalysts in Alkaline Media

open access: yesIsrael Journal of Chemistry, Volume 66, Issue 4, July 2026.
We synthesized Ru‐modified Cu1.8Se/Cu2Se electrocatalysts using solvothermal–annealing for alkaline hydrogen evolution reaction. A minimal 2.1 wt% Ru catalyst exhibited a low overpotential of 169 mV at 10 mA cm−2 with excellent stability, approaching the performance of Pt/C.

Silver‐Alloyed Wide‐Bandgap (Ag,Cu)(In,Ga)S2 Thin‐Film Solar Cells With 15.5% Efficiency

open access: yesProgress in Photovoltaics: Research and Applications, Volume 34, Issue 7, Page 942-956, July 2026.
This study reports improvements in compositional homogeneity, microstructure, enhanced radiative recombination, and extended carrier lifetime of CIGS absorber via Ag incorporation. The optimal Ag‐alloyed CIGS solar cells achieve 15.5% PCE and 948 mV VOC, competing with the VOC of the Ag‐free reference sample from the same batch.

A Generalized Automated Framework for Thermal Characterization: From Bulk Materials to Complex Heterostructures

open access: yesSmall, Volume 22, Issue 37, 2 July 2026.
An automated MATLAB framework for inverse photoacoustic analysis enables precise thermal characterization of complex multilayer films. Application to electrodeposited CuxSe reveals a stoichiometry‐dependent thermal conductivity governed by lattice anharmonicity, not grain‐size scattering, in these superionic materials.
